Alpine and its attractions for beach lovers
Alpine, nestled in the East County of San Diego, may not have direct beach access, but it offers a gateway to some stunning coastal experiences just a short drive away. One must-visit spot is the scenic Lake Jennings, perfect for families looking to enjoy a day of fishing, kayaking, or picnicking by the water, all while taking in the beautiful natural surroundings. For adventure seekers, the Cuyamaca Rancho State Park offers hiking trails that lead to breathtaking vistas and the chance to explore the lush pine forest, ideal for a family day out or a romantic hike. If you're inclined to explore local history, check out the Alpine Historical Society, where you can discover the rich heritage of this quaint mountain town. For a taste of local culture, the Alpine Community Center often hosts events and markets that showcase the vibrant community spirit.
